Summary: C.A. No. 005456/2004 - K.C. Chandrashekhar Raju v. Custodian The Supreme Court disposed of the appeal on March 5, 2013, affirming the High Court's January 21, 2004 order directing the appellant to hand over possession of Flat No. 14 (instead of Flat No. 19) and receive Rs. 8,54,660.29 from the custodian's attached account. The Court rejected the appellant's challenge that the order was passed without hearing and clarified that the appellant remains at liberty to approach the High Court with fresh applications to claim additional compensation if the flat's value exceeds the amount received, provided such claims are supported by evidence from prior Court orders.
